BBQ Chicken Recipe – DIY

There’s something about barbecues that brings families together around the world.
The Aussies bring out their large ‘barbies’ every chance they get, while having a
barbecue picnic in the back garden is a favourite British summertime activity.

India of course has its own tandoori food that’s been a staple for centuries, and the
technique has found its way into many modern dishes as well. In this exciting recipe,
we show you how to barbecue a whole chicken with Indian spices.

Start with a true Indian marinade made with fresh yoghurt, ginger-garlic paste,
mustard oil, lemon juice and a bunch of spices, let the chicken rest for an hour, then
grill for a mouth-watering smoky chicken that everyone will just love – we can
guarantee that!

Serve with a side of roasted or mashed potatoes, or some lovely steamed veg.
